Hi all,

I upgraded my desktop last weekend and decided to try the new *uvideo*driver 
from OpenBSD.

When I run |pwcview|, the image is displayed incorrectly: it is horizontally 
duplicated and shows interlaced lines.

If I switch back to |webcamd|, the webcam works normally.

I also tested it with *Google Meet*and *Jitsi Meet*in Firefox.

On Google Meet, I receive a warning indicating that my webcam is not 
functioning properly.

Has anyone experienced this issue or have any suggestions on how to 
troubleshoot it?

My web cam is HD Pro C920 USB

When uvideo load, show this message

uvideo0 on uhub1
uvideo0: <vendor 0x046d HD Pro Webcam C920, class 239/2, rev 2.00/0.11, addr 3> 
on usbus0
uvideo0: too many PU descriptors found!
uvideo0: too many PU descriptors found!
uvideo0: too many PU descriptors found!
uvideo0: too many PU descriptors found!
uvideo0: too many PU descriptors found!
uvideo0: too many PU descriptors found!
uvideo0: too many PU descriptors found!
uvideo0: too many PU descriptors found!
uvideo0: too many PU descriptors found!
uvideo0: too many PU descriptors found!
uvideo0: 3 format(s), iface_index=1, endpoint=0x81, psize=3060, isoc
uvideo0: default format: pixfmt=0x56595559, 640x480, max_fbuf=4147200
uvideo0: UVC camera on /dev/video0


try updating UVIDEO_MAX_PU and UVIDEO_MAX_CT from 8 to 32.

in sys/dev/usb/video/uvideo.c
